The Japanese Ministry of Health, Labour and Welfare requires all international visitors to submit their passport number and nationality when registering at any lodging facility (inns, hotels, motels etc). Additionally, lodging proprietors are required to photocopy passports for all registering guests and keep the photocopy on file.

More like a strict camp rather than a holiday hote
It's like a Ryokan experience, so not really for me, neither for my Japanese partner... Breakfast can only be had very early in the morning, you can choose 7 or 8am (they banged our door at 8:03am when we weren't at the breakfast table yet). The onsen hot springs can only be used until 23:00 with booking (and no extra towels provided there), so basically you need to plan your entire trip around the hotel schedule. We hate this kind of attitude. Futons will be put out by the staff, but the noisy old Aircon will blow directly on you.
